Secondly, why do different animals need different food?
For survival , different animals have to resort to different food and feeding habits so as to reduce the number of animal species eating the same. This way the competition to acquire food reduces and every animal in that habitat can eat to their fullest.

What are the three types of Vores?
Three different types of animals exist: herbivores, omnivores, and carnivores. Herbivores are animals that eat only plants. Carnivores are animals that eat only meat. Omnivores are animals that eat both plants and meat.How do animals gather food?
